Migrate tickets from another helpdesk solution into LogMeIn Resolve

The easiest way to migrate your tickets into LogMeIn Resolve is by utilizing our API. However, if it is only a small number of tickets you want to migrate, you can email them to your selected helpdesk service set up in GoTo Admin.

While you can use the API or email methods to migrate your existing tickets into LogMeIn Resolve, it is currently not possible to preserve some of the original properties (such as the creation date) of the tickets.

Use the LogMeIn Resolve API for ticket migration

Before you begin: Set up authentication to use the LogMeIn Resolve API.
Using the LogMeIn Resolve API, you can create an uploader script that uploads the data of all your tickets to the Console.
Important: When using the script, the ticket creation date will be set to the date the tickets were uploaded. This cannot be customized.
  1. Create an uploader script based on the request samples provided in our API documentation for creating a new incident.
  2. Upload your tickets to LogMeIn Resolve.

Results: Your tickets appear in the Helpdesk menu of the Console with the Created date set as the date the upload was completed.

Email your tickets to LogMeIn Resolve

This approach is only recommended if you have a small number of tickets to migrate from your previous helpdesk solution into LogMeIn Resolve.
  1. Optional: Set up a new helpdesk service to keep your end-users' ticketing flow separate from the migration flow.
  2. Send an email to your helpdesk service's email address with the contents of your ticket. Repeat this step for each ticket you want to migrate.

Results: Your tickets appear in the Helpdesk menu of the Console with the Created date set as the date you emailed your tickets to the helpdesk service.
